In Indiana, the changing seasons directly impact water damage risks. Spring can bring melting snow and heavy rains, leading to saturated ground and potential basement flooding, especially in older homes common around Indianapolis. Winter presents the threat of frozen pipes bursting, causing sudden and severe interior water damage. How quickly does mold grow after water damage?

Mold spores are microscopic and present in most environments. After water damage occurs, mold can begin to colonize on damp surfaces within 24 to 48 hours. Prompt and thorough drying is essential to prevent mold from becoming a widespread problem.

Can I do water restoration myself in Indiana?

For very minor water spills, some DIY cleanup might be possible. However, significant water damage in Indiana homes, especially from issues like burst pipes or basement flooding, often requires specialized equipment and expertise for proper drying and to prevent secondary problems like mold. Professional intervention is usually recommended.
